Transaction 59851026a2ef9fd01d8fa2c3c16b0063021cb2bbd860f501ff916279be3f33e9
2 Input
2 Outputs
- 59851026a2ef9fd01d8fa2c3c16b0063021cb2bbd860f501ff916279be3f33e9:0
- 59851026a2ef9fd01d8fa2c3c16b0063021cb2bbd860f501ff916279be3f33e9:1
value 14462
address 14x45ibqExJs8W5YpwwmvNyw1sra7KYe9e
value 18000000
address 3D3yWFMhR5uDBDcyDqsDkq8gUrwWXtHViV